Subject: Cut-over complete — Lanepoint autocomplete

Team,

Cut-over finished last night. The Lanepoint address autocomplete widget now runs on the new suggestion backend everywhere. Old endpoint is read-only until Friday, then gone. Expected support impact: customers may notice slightly different ranking of suburb matches; this is intended. If someone reports empty dropdowns, have them hard-refresh first — cached bundles are the usual cause. Escalate anything else to Marit. For troubleshooting, the widget's live settings are below.

— Dov

settings of yageg-yahap:
[gorael]
team = olieth
access_code = ac_941d74
owner = brieth.aldiel
host = gorael.tolvaqio.internal
port = 6379
peer = briwyn.urlaqtech.internal
salt = 116e6622
pin = 1957

Subject: Guest Wi-Fi desk — what to tell visitors

Hi all,

Welcome to the Bramleigh front desk. Visitors asking about internet access should be sent to the guest Wi-Fi desk at reception, left of the planters. Always confirm their host has signed them in before issuing credentials, and remind them access expires at 18:00. To unlock the credential printer cabinet, enter the code below.

staff pass of kagup-fajog = bdg-QCHVQW-99665837

Ticket: LiftLogic simulator build rejected at deploy

The elevator-dispatch simulator for the Carradine tower model fails its signature check after the build host was reimaged. The artifact is fine; the verifier's keyring was wiped. Future maintainers: reimaging always clears the keyring, so restore it before deploying. The signing key to restore is:

deploy key for kajof-fajop: bky6_gDHw9Q